WebApr 13, 2024 · If you use a CPAP machine, then mouth breathing could inhibit the effectiveness of that machine. In a 2004 study, 51 patients diagnosed as nasal breathers or mouth breathers used a CPAP machine for the first time. Researchers found mouth breathers were less adherent to CPAP therapy than nasal breathers. WebOct 17, 2011 · Not only does CPAP help restore the surface area extension of the lung, it also aids airways at risk for collapse due to excessive fluid. The goal is to decrease the work of breathing, saving valuable energy, as well as to make sure adequate gas exchange is present. WebJun 17, 2015 · Positive pressure ventilation affects preload, afterload and ventricular compliance. The net effect in most situations is a decrease in cardiac output. However, the effect may be beneficial in the context of decompensated heart failure, where the decreased preload and afterload result in a return to a more productive part of the Starling curve.
